Ministry
(gcide)
Ministry \Min"is*try\, n.; pl. Ministries . [L. ministerium. See
Minister, n., and cf. Mystery a trade.]
[1913 Webster]
1. The act of ministering; ministration; service. "With
tender ministry." --Thomson.
[1913 Webster]

2. Hence: Agency; instrumentality.
[1913 Webster]

The ordinary ministry of second causes. --Atterbury.
[1913 Webster]

The wicked ministry of arms. --Dryden.
[1913 Webster]

3. The office, duties, or functions of a minister, servant,
or agent; ecclesiastical, executive, or ambassadorial
function or profession.
[1913 Webster]

4. The body of ministers of state; also, the clergy, as a
body.
[1913 Webster]

5. Administration; rule; term in power; as, the ministry of
Pitt.
[1913 Webster]
ministry
(wn)
ministry
n 1: religious ministers collectively (especially Presbyterian)
2: building where the business of a government department is
transacted
3: a government department under the direction of a minister
4: the work of a minister of religion; "he is studying for the
ministry"
